The 2019 Development Informatics Scholarship covers tuition fees, flights and living costs.  It is available for applicants from Ghana, Kenya, Zambia or Zimbabwe to Manchester's one-year MSc ICTs-for-Development (https://www.manchester.ac.uk/study/masters/courses/list/06237/msc-icts-for-development/)

Scholarships include costs of overseas fieldwork (see, e.g. https://twitter.com/hashtag/dig2017_sa).

Applicants should apply for the scholarship by 31 March.  Details and eligibility at: https://www.gdi.manchester.ac.uk/study/taught-masters/funding-opportunities/gdi-merit-awards/
